About
Anja Maier is a pioneering researcher at the intersection of human-robot interaction, design aesthetics, and sustainable technology. Her work fundamentally shapes how we understand and implement human-centric technologies in Industry 5.0. Maier’s most significant contribution is her classification of robot morphologies, which provides a systematic framework for understanding how design aesthetics influence human perception and interaction with robots—a critical foundation for creating more acceptable and effective workplace robots. Her innovative research extends to tactile sensing, where she has developed a novel opto-tactile approach using DIGIT sensors that enables robots to handle delicate objects like strawberries with unprecedented precision, detecting subtle deformations that were previously impossible to measure. Maier also explores the intersection of immersive technologies and behavior change, investigating how virtual and augmented reality can sustain long-term behavioral shifts in sustainability and health contexts. With her work spanning from theoretical frameworks to practical applications, including information visualization for complex engineering systems, Maier’s research has garnered increasing attention, with her most-cited paper on robot design aesthetics accumulating 10 citations since 2024. Her multidisciplinary approach positions her as a leading voice in creating technologies that are not only functional but also aesthetically and psychologically attuned to human needs.
